Can a Corydoras Catfish Live With a Bristlenose Pleco?

Yes — a corydoras catfish and bristlenose pleco are generally compatible.

Temperatures line up — both thrive around 73–78°F.
pH preferences overlap (6.5–7.5) — easy to keep both comfortable.
Plan on at least 25 gallons for the pair (the larger of their two minimums).
